Insurance Institute Names Top 10 Safest Cars
The Ford Five Hundred and Mercury Montego, when equipped with optional side airbags, earned a Gold “Top Safety Pick” award for large cars from the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ety. The Audi A6 was given the Silver award for large cars.
The Five Hundred and Montego are corporate “twins,” stylistically different versions of the same car.
Vehicles that received Gold awards earned “good” ratings — the best possible — for front-, side- and rear-impact protection. Vehicles that were rated good for front- and side-impact protection and “acceptable” for rear-impact protection earned Silver awards.
Pickups and SUVs weren’t included in this round of awards because side impact tests of most of these vehicles haven’t been conducted yet.
